Ocean System Past Earnings Performance
We're still processing the latest earnings report of this company
Past criteria checks 5/6
Ocean System has been growing earnings at an average annual rate of 6.5%, while the Consumer Retailing industry saw earnings growing at 9.5% annually. Revenues have been growing at an average rate of 8% per year. Ocean System's return on equity is 11.9%, and it has net margins of 1.4%.
Key information
6.5%
Earnings growth rate
7.5%
EPS growth rate
Consumer Retailing Industry Growth | 7.8% |
Revenue growth rate | 8.0% |
Return on equity | 11.9% |
Net Margin | 1.4% |
Last Earnings Update | 30 Jun 2024 |
Recent past performance updates
Recent updates
Statutory Profit Doesn't Reflect How Good Ocean System's (TSE:3096) Earnings Are
May 22The Attractive Combination That Could Earn Ocean System Corporation (TYO:3096) A Place In Your Dividend Portfolio
Apr 22With EPS Growth And More, Ocean System (TYO:3096) Is Interesting
Apr 07How Much Of Ocean System Corporation (TYO:3096) Do Insiders Own?
Mar 20Can Ocean System (TYO:3096) Continue To Grow Its Returns On Capital?
Mar 07Can You Imagine How Ocean System's (TYO:3096) Shareholders Feel About The 34% Share Price Increase?
Feb 22Ocean System (TYO:3096) Has A Pretty Healthy Balance Sheet
Feb 09Ocean System Corporation (TYO:3096) Stock Has Shown Weakness Lately But Financials Look Strong: Should Prospective Shareholders Make The Leap?
Jan 27Is Ocean System Corporation (TYO:3096) An Attractive Dividend Stock?
Jan 14I Ran A Stock Scan For Earnings Growth And Ocean System (TYO:3096) Passed With Ease
Jan 01Here's What Ocean System Corporation's (TYO:3096) Shareholder Ownership Structure Looks Like
Dec 19Will the Promising Trends At Ocean System (TYO:3096) Continue?
Dec 06Ocean System (TYO:3096) Shareholders Have Enjoyed A 34% Share Price Gain
Nov 23Revenue & Expenses Breakdown
How Ocean System makes and spends money. Based on latest reported earnings, on an LTM basis.
Earnings and Revenue History
Date | Revenue | Earnings | G+A Expenses | R&D Expenses |
---|---|---|---|---|
30 Jun 24 | 87,497 | 1,266 | 17,821 | 0 |
31 Mar 24 | 85,899 | 1,337 | 17,495 | 0 |
31 Dec 23 | 83,583 | 968 | 16,958 | 0 |
30 Sep 23 | 81,119 | 730 | 16,638 | 0 |
30 Jun 23 | 79,138 | 556 | 16,434 | 0 |
31 Mar 23 | 77,710 | 358 | 16,250 | 0 |
31 Dec 22 | 77,031 | 697 | 16,133 | 0 |
30 Sep 22 | 75,687 | 780 | 15,872 | 0 |
30 Jun 22 | 74,115 | 806 | 15,641 | 0 |
31 Mar 22 | 72,700 | 798 | 15,435 | 0 |
31 Dec 21 | 70,845 | 817 | 15,239 | 0 |
30 Sep 21 | 69,132 | 780 | 14,982 | 0 |
30 Jun 21 | 67,903 | 830 | 14,694 | 0 |
31 Mar 21 | 66,906 | 858 | 14,542 | 0 |
31 Dec 20 | 66,304 | 949 | 14,288 | 0 |
30 Sep 20 | 65,012 | 946 | 14,135 | 0 |
30 Jun 20 | 64,019 | 910 | 14,008 | 0 |
31 Mar 20 | 61,999 | 835 | 13,752 | 0 |
31 Dec 19 | 60,047 | 625 | 13,470 | 0 |
30 Sep 19 | 59,088 | 556 | 13,360 | 0 |
30 Jun 19 | 58,094 | 522 | 13,206 | 0 |
31 Mar 19 | 57,355 | 485 | 13,093 | 0 |
31 Dec 18 | 56,641 | 508 | 12,933 | 0 |
30 Sep 18 | 54,980 | 544 | 12,587 | 0 |
30 Jun 18 | 53,334 | 526 | 12,321 | 0 |
31 Mar 18 | 51,967 | 503 | 12,047 | 0 |
31 Dec 17 | 50,787 | 487 | 11,825 | 0 |
30 Sep 17 | 50,559 | 474 | 11,756 | 0 |
30 Jun 17 | 50,292 | 493 | 11,665 | 0 |
31 Mar 17 | 49,952 | 487 | 11,573 | 0 |
31 Dec 16 | 49,754 | 579 | 11,416 | 0 |
30 Sep 16 | 49,240 | 574 | 11,273 | 0 |
30 Jun 16 | 48,863 | 580 | 11,157 | 0 |
31 Mar 16 | 48,475 | 537 | 11,090 | 0 |
31 Dec 15 | 47,620 | 167 | 10,969 | 0 |
30 Sep 15 | 46,761 | 161 | 10,804 | 0 |
30 Jun 15 | 46,198 | 142 | 10,660 | 0 |
31 Mar 15 | 45,172 | 127 | 10,485 | 0 |
31 Dec 14 | 45,102 | 404 | 10,354 | 0 |
30 Sep 14 | 44,851 | 356 | 10,287 | 0 |
30 Jun 14 | 44,447 | 326 | 10,175 | 0 |
31 Mar 14 | 44,414 | 340 | 10,118 | 0 |
31 Dec 13 | 43,927 | 410 | 10,104 | 0 |
Quality Earnings: 3096 has high quality earnings.
Growing Profit Margin: 3096's current net profit margins (1.4%) are higher than last year (0.7%).
Free Cash Flow vs Earnings Analysis
Past Earnings Growth Analysis
Earnings Trend: 3096's earnings have grown by 6.5% per year over the past 5 years.
Accelerating Growth: 3096's earnings growth over the past year (127.7%) exceeds its 5-year average (6.5% per year).
Earnings vs Industry: 3096 earnings growth over the past year (127.7%) exceeded the Consumer Retailing industry 14.1%.
Return on Equity
High ROE: 3096's Return on Equity (11.9%) is considered low.